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Exeter to Tuscany is to train and fly which costs €110 - €280 and takes 5h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Exeter to Tuscany is to train and fly which takes 5h 55m and costs €110 - €280.
No, there is no direct bus from Exeter to Tuscany station. However, there are services departing from Bampfylde Street and arriving at Florence Villa Constanza Bus Station via London Victoria Green Line Station and Luxembourg Park&Drive.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 30h 33m.
The distance between Exeter and Tuscany is 1354 km.
The best way to get from Exeter to Tuscany without a car is to train and bus via Dover which takes 22h 13m and costs €270 - €600.
It takes approximately 6h 53m to get from Exeter to Tuscany, including transfers.
Exeter to Tuscany b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Bampfylde Street station.
The best way to get from Exeter to Tuscany is to fly which takes 6h 53m and costs €180 - €310.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s and takes 30h 33m.
Exeter to Tuscany b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at London Victoria Coach Station Arrivals.
Tuscany is 1h ahead of Exeter. It is currently 6:30 PM in Exeter and 7:30 PM in Tuscany.
